E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ures the enchanting Goblin hoodoo formations at Goblin Valley State Park in Utah, United States of America. The unique rock formations, resembling mischievous goblins, stand tall against a backdrop of clear blue skies and rugged rocky terrain. The balanced rocks seem to defy gravity as they precariously perch upon one another, creating an awe-inspiring sight that showcases the power and beauty of nature. Each formation is meticulously shaped by years of erosion and weathering, resulting in these whimsical figures that spark the imagination. Located in North America's stunning Utah region, this natural wonderland offers a surreal experience for travelers seeking adventure and exploration.
